One Charged, Two Sought for Homosexual Assault

An Amherstburg man is facing five charges after an incident police are treating as a hate crime. Police say two men were inside a Pizza Pizza franchise a Oulette and University when they endured an incident of verbal gay bashing. One of the victims confronted the assailant and was punched, a blow that broke his nose and cheekbone. 

Twenty-seven year old Raymond Meloche of Amherstburg faces charges of incitement of hatred, assault causing bodily harm, assaulting a police officer and resisting arrest. Police are looking for two other men.  Kelly Roche had the story.
